u/aufbau1s 21h ago
I think it might actually be that he doesn’t know how to position / target select as well as top midlaners in major regions.
Since ryze is lower range this causes him to get caught / be mispositioned
For example, in the one dragon fight where DSG comes back it’s pretty much solely on him for getting caught as they try to move to dragon.
This honestly could be part of the comms gap since it might be that he knows where he should be but can’t communicate to the team to play around it, but I think it’s more a mental gap.
I think he’s not used to having to think about it that tightly because in tier 2 he wasn’t punished because he could hands check. I think it’s the same issue as why he ends up losing C9 the team fights on the Akali against TL. He expects to be able to just dive and hand check Yeon, but when Yeon passes the check he’s now too far forward

u/kazuyaminegishi 22h ago
Yeah, I mean Toast has been pretty vocal that he's basically a farm team for the bigger LCS teams. He doesn't have the budget to compete on contract basis, and the slot doesn't have the security to pull in any known quantities that are strong.
It's no shock the org is struggling to get a footing they were basically thrown to the wolves. That's why DIG being almost as bad as them is extra funny cause DIG's only excuse is no one wants to join them cause they're a shit org. DSG is an alright org in a shit position.
